## 内容主体大纲 1. 引言 - 以太坊简介 - 钱包地址的重要性 2. 以太坊钱包地址的生成 - 以太坊地址生成的机制 - 地址的唯一性与安全性 3. 以太坊钱包地址是否无限 - 理论上无限的可能性 - 实际使用中的局限性 4. 如何管理多个以太坊地址 - 钱包管理工具 - 地址使用与管理的最佳实践 5. 常见问题解答 - 以太坊地址的安全性 - 钱包地址与私钥的关系 - 如何恢复丢失的以太坊钱包地址 - 以太坊地址转移的过程 - 钱包地址的匿名性与透明性 - 以太坊地址与交易费用 6. 结论 - 钱包地址的前景与发展 - 用户应注意的事项 ## 正文 ### 引言

以太坊是一个全球化的开源平台,旨在让开发者能够构建和部署分布式应用(DApps)。其核心特性之一是交易和数据的去中心化处理,钱包地址作为用户与以太坊生态系统交互的关键,是不可或缺的一部分。本文将探讨以太坊钱包地址是否真的是无限的这一问题,并探讨其生成、管理及相关的安全性和隐私性问题。

### 以太坊钱包地址的生成

以太坊钱包地址是通过生成一个公私钥对来创建的。这个过程是基于一种加密算法,通常是以椭圆曲线密码学(ECC)为基础。首先,生成一个256位的随机数作为私钥,然后通过该私钥生成一个公钥,最后再通过哈希算法生成一个40个十六进制字符组成的以太坊地址。这个地址是独一无二的,几乎不可能重复。

以太坊地址的唯一性来自于地址格式的设计。以太坊地址以“0x”开头,后面跟随一个40位的十六进制字符串。由于它基于广泛的几何空间,理论上可以生成2^160个不同的地址,几乎可以视为无限。

### 以太坊钱包地址是否无限

理论上,生成以太坊地址的过程中可以创建无限的地址。这是因为,每一次生成新地址时,都是随机选取的256位私钥。这意味着生成的地址在数学上是无限的。不过,在实际使用中,虽然理论上存在无穷多个地址,但人们在使用、管理和存储这些地址时会受到设备、存储空间等实际限制影响。

此外,虽然生成地址是“无限”的,但在区块链网络中,用户频繁使用的地址数量并不能达到它的理论极限。比如,许多用户可能只会使用有限的几个地址进行交易。对于大部分用户来说,他们只需要少数几个活跃的地址,这样更易于管理和保持资金安全。

### 如何管理多个以太坊地址

随着用户在以太坊网络上进行交易,管理多个钱包地址显得尤为重要。对于希望同时使用多个地址的用户,选择合适的管理工具至关重要。

首先,用户可以选择一些常见的钱包管理工具,这些工具能帮助用户集中管理多个地址。例如,MetaMask是一个流行的浏览器扩展,支持生成和管理多条以太坊地址的功能。其次,用户还可以借助硬件钱包来存储私钥,并在其中生成多个地址。硬件钱包如Ledger或Trezor提供更高的安全性,适合长期持有资产。

管理多个地址时,有几点最佳实践建议:首先,尽量给每个地址标注名称或备注,以便于区分其用途;其次,定期备份、更新私钥和助记符;最后,确保使用高强度的密码和二步验证来维护账户安全。

### 常见问题解答 ####

以太坊地址的安全性

以太坊地址本身并不存储资金,真正的资产是存储在与地址相关联的私钥中。私钥是用来进行交易和签名的,因此保证私钥的安全性至关重要。以下是一些确保以太坊地址安全的技巧:

1. **确保私钥安全**:私钥绝对不能与他人分享,也不要在不安全的环境中存储。它可以保存在离线设备或专用的硬件钱包中。

2. **使用强密码**:在钱包应用中设置强密码,并使用二步验证来增强安全性。

3. **定期备份**:定期备份钱包的助记词或私钥,并将其储存在安全的地方,例如加密的USB驱动器。

####

钱包地址与私钥的关系

以太坊地址和私钥之间的关系密不可分。每个以太坊地址都有一个对应的私钥,私钥是生成地址的唯一凭证。没有私钥,用户将无法访问其通过该地址持有的以太坊资产。以下是与私钥相关的关键点:

1. **生成过程**:每个以太坊地址都是基于其相应的私钥生成的,因此地址的安全性源于私钥的保密性。

2. **私钥丢失的后果**:如果用户丢失了私钥,相关的以太坊地址及其资产也将无法恢复,这就是为什么定期备份私钥至关重要。

####

如何恢复丢失的以太坊钱包地址

如果用户丢失了与以太坊地址关联的私钥,这个地址将是无法再访问的。但是,如果用户记住助记符,在一些钱包中,可以通过助记符恢复钱包。这是通过一种特定的恢复流程来进行的:

1. **使用助记符**:在选择的新钱包软件中,选择“导入钱包”或“恢复钱包”选项,输入助记符。

2. **重新生成地址及私钥**: 软件会使用助记符重新生成地址及其对应私钥,使用户重新获得对资产的控制。

####

以太坊地址转移的过程

以太坊地址之间的资产转移是通过签名交易实现的。用户需要输入接收地址、待发送金额以及确认交易信息,然后签名确认。具体流程如下:

1. **输入转账信息**:在钱包中,用户选择“发送”或“转账”选项,输入收款地址和转账金额。

2. **支付交易费用**:以太坊上进行交易是需要支付一定的Gas费,完成交易前,用户需要确认支付这笔费用。

3. **确认交易**:用户确认所有信息无误后,提交该交易,钱包会使用私钥签名交易数据。该交易信息将被广播到以太坊网络中,等待确认。

####

钱包地址的匿名性与透明性

以太坊网络的透明性是其核心特性之一。所有交易都在区块链上公开记录。尽管交易透明,但通过以太坊地址本身,用户的真实身份是匿名的。以下是关于这一主题的讨论:

1. **交易透明性**:在区块链上,所有交易数据对所有用户可见,包括发起和接收地址、交易金额及时间戳。

2. **匿名性**:虽然交易透明,但用户并不需要使用真实身份注册钱包地址。因此,除非用户将地址与真实世界身份关联,否则难以追踪。

####

以太坊地址与交易费用

在以太坊网络上,进行交易会涉及到Gas费用。每一笔交易都有一个Gas费用,根据交易复杂性不同,费用也会有所区别:

1. **Gas的定义**:Gas是以太坊网络中执行交易或智能合约所需的计算单位。每个操作和存储都需要消耗Gas。

2. **费用计算**:交易费用=Gas数量*Gas价格。用户可以在不同的网络拥堵期间调整Gas价格,以确保交易能及时被处理。

### 结论

综上所述,尽管以太坊钱包地址在理论上是“无限”的,但实际使用中,用户对地址的需求是有限的。用户需要管理和保护好自己的私钥,以确保在使用以太坊网络时资产的安全。未来,随着更多用户和开发者涌现,地址生成与管理工具也会不断进步,为用户提供更佳的体验。同时,在去中心化金融(DeFi)及智能合约的推动下,钱包地址的功能也将愈加丰富,用户应保持警惕,随时关注行业发展与变化。